添加剂马来酸二烯丙基酯与TMSB对锂离子电池性能影响
Effect of Diallyl Maleate and TMSB Additive on the Performance of Lithium Ion Battery
【摘要】 用1 mol.L-1LiPF6/碳酸乙烯基酯(EC)+碳酸二甲基酯(DMC)(EC、DMC体积比为1:1)作为锂离子电池电解液,用1%三(三甲基硅烷)硼酸酯(TMSB)+1%马来酸二烯丙基酯作为其电解液添加剂.研究了锂离子电池首次充放电性能与循环充放电性能,结果表明添加剂马来酸二烯丙基酯能与添加剂TMSB协同改善锂离子电池的性能.
【Abstract】 Diallyl maleate +TMSB with a volume ratio of 1% was added to the electrolyte containing 1 mol?L-1 LiPF6 in ethylene carbonate(EC),dimethyl carbonate(DMC)(1∶1 by volume).`The first charging discharging and the performance of lithium ion battery were studied,The results indicated that Diallyl maleate can cooperates with TMSB to improve the performance of lithium ion battery.
